<p>When <em>one small seed</em> was first ‘sowed’ by founder/editor-in-chief Giuseppe Russo, the idea was to encourage a South African creative movement that could compete with the world. Nine years on, it’s grown into a creative network (<a href="http://www.onesmallseed.net/" target="_blank">onesmallseed.net</a>), various online platforms – including two new initiatives called <a href="http://www.cultofself.org/" target="_blank">‘Cult of Self’</a> and <a href="https://www.facebook.com/WeLoveSexy?fref=ts" target="_blank">‘We Love Sexy’</a> – and we’re excited to re-launch as a digital magazine.</p>
<p>Blood, sweat and tears went into nourishing the growth of this ‘diversely branched tree’, yet its seed would never have sprouted without the ground-breaking content contributed by artists, photographers, models, musicians, architects, designers, writers or – as the umbrella term neatly summarises – ‘creatives’. The Vodafone Firsts campaign thus seemed an ideal opportunity for us to touch base with some of ‘the creative influencers’ who have featured in past issues. Lindiwe Suttle, Jack Parow and Sam Norval shared their ‘one small seed firsts’, ‘creative firsts’ and current projects that might inspire further firsts for aspiring creatives.</p>

<p>Lindiwe Suttle’s &#8216;first&#8217; with <em>one small seed</em> goes all the way back to <a href="http://www.onesmallseed.com/2005/09/issue-01-online/" target="_blank">the first issue</a> – that’s when she saw the magazine for the first time and found it &#8216;immediately intriguing&#8217;. In <a href="http://www.onesmallseed.com/2006/02/issue-02-online/" target="_blank">issue 02</a>, she was featured in it and, according to her, it was the first shoot she did before launching her music career. &#8216;It inspired me to make change through my art. It was such a refreshing magazine to have in SA because, from the start, it focused on artists that were true artists – non-conformist artists who didn’t follow any rules,&#8217; she says.</p>
<p>Produced in Berlin by Ivan Gregoriev and mastered by Dave Clutch (Alicia Keys, John Legend, Foo Fighters) in New York, her solo debut <a href="https://itunes.apple.com/de/album/id844473286" target="_blank"><em>Kamikaze Art</em></a> just won her ‘Songwriter of the Year’ and ‘Best Female Artist and Composer/co-composer’ at The Wawela Music Awards 2014. In the same vein, but different creative field, as her talk show star mother Felicia Mabuza-Suttle, she’s an ambitioned young lady ready to take up any challenge thrown her way. Currently, she’s working on Enough (Set Us Free), a girls’ and women’s rights campaign that makes use of a song she wrote the lyrics for, and her partner – German rock legend Marius Mueller-Westernhagen – composed. &#8216;I hope it inspires other artists to use their music to speak out for others that have no voice&#8217;.</p>

<p>Jack Parow is known for his pep-store <em>broek</em> style and general anti-coolness. So uncool that – according to his recent single <a href="https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=NvcdEx-kdSk&#038;feature=kp" target="_blank">‘Bloubek’</a> – ‘he eats fucking hipsters and shits out fixie bikes’. Cool enough, however, for sexy swimsuit model girlfriend Jenna Pietersen, he somehow made it from <em>Boerewors</em> curtain-protected Bellville to dangerously trendy Cape Town – he says it’s &#8216;overpopulated by the hip graphic design crowd&#8217;.</p>
<p>His first with <em>one small seed</em> was &#8216;somewhere like Mr. Pickwicks&#8217; and – according to him – it caused him &#8216;great social anxiety and overall discomfort because people originally from Joburg or some other country like Italy were acting like they’re Capetonian&#8217;. Once his nervousness was overcome, he was inspired to write <a href="https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=lRzFqW4Xh2k&#038;feature=kp" target="_blank">‘Cooler as Ekke’</a>, which further &#8216;established his feelings on what he thought about <em>one small seed</em> and all the ‘cool’ people&#8217;. So much that he references the mag in the song. ‘Jy dink jy’s cooler as ek, omdat jy die nuwe issue van <em>one small seed</em> het.’ Shortly after its release he was featured in <a href="http://www.onesmallseed.com/2011/03/issue-18-online/" target="_blank">issue 18</a> of <em>one small seed magazine</em>.</p>
<p><em><a href="https://itunes.apple.com/za/album/nag-van-die-lang-pette/id773098435" target="_blank">Nag van die Lang Pette</a></em> (2014), available at South African music stores now, is his most recent project. He worked very hard on this album so he hopes that it’ll inspire more people to work hard for the first time. Cool or uncool – his rhymes will continue to piss off conservative <em>mense</em> due to the raw wit, side-splitting humour and (true!?) portrayal of culture. Jack Parow is SA’s &#8216;zef darling&#8217; and will be in the Rainbow Nation’s hearts forever.</p>

<p>Photographer Sam Norval lives in New York and has photographed celebrities such as Clint Eastwood, Flea, Norah Jones, Billy Joel and B.B. King. Yet he says that the first time he was allowed to explore his own style was when he did his first shoot, after he got back home to South Africa, for <em>one small seed</em>. Deep into that <em>Darkness Peering…</em> for <a href="http://www.onesmallseed.com/2011/03/issue-13-online/" target="_blank">issue 13</a> was an homage to Tim Burton that perfectly accentuated Sam’s &#8216;dark and moody style&#8217;. According to him it was the first time &#8216;I was really allowed to explore that genre. I was allowed to be as creative as I wanted to be&#8217;. Further &#8216;photography firsts&#8217; were to follow as he shot:</p>

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><strong><a href="http://www.picturetree.co.za/" target="_blank">Picture Tree</a>’s Fausto Becatti is the director behind <a href="http://www.spoekmathambo.com/" target="_blank">Spoek Mathambo</a> brand new video for <a href="http://www.diesel.com/diesel+edun/" target="_blank">Diesel+EDUN</a>’s Studio Africa project. Titled <em>Awufuni</em>  &#8211; or You Should Have Called (My Heart) &#8211; the clip is a colour-saturated, high-energy tribute to modern women that also exposes the vibrancy, creativity, and rich culture of South Africa.</strong></p>
<p><iframe width="600" height="338" src="//www.youtube.com/embed/sTg2nZI34Kw" frameborder="0" allowfullscreen></iframe></p>
<blockquote><p>I wanted to celebrate exciting modern women – the strength of it, the fun of it, the flavour of it (Mathambo)</p></blockquote>
<p>Featured on the musician, rapper and producer’s recent mixtape, <em>Escape from ‘85</em>, <em>Awufuni</em> is Mathambo’s take on the song of the same name by an old school South African girl group from the 60s, Izintombi Zesi Manje Manje (‘Women of the now’). </p>
<p>‘A group of five girls form a futuristic gang, in a surreal way,’ says Becatti of the core creative concept of the video. </p>
<p>‘There’s a main storyline where Spoek is on a date with this girl and she leads him into this scrapyard. He eventually tries to escape but she chases him and the girls then tie him up and perform this ritualistic dance around him.’</p>

<p>In creating the storyboard, Becatti added his vision to Spoek’s inspiration for the video. The two had been looking for an opportunity to work together since meeting earlier in 2013. ‘When the Diesel+EDUN’s Studio Africa project came along, Spoek and I knew the perfect opportunity had presented itself,’ comments Becatti.</p>
<p>Creating Awufuni was a multinational effort that was spearheaded by VICE Magazine on behalf of Diesel+EDUN. Edun, a clothing label founded by Bono’s wife, Ali Hewson, has worked with Diesel on a two-season clothing collection with the most recent one being a 35-piece denim focused collection entirely manufactured in Africa with CCI cotton from Uganda.</p>
<p>The video’s cross-continental creative collaboration stretched from Italy (Diesel) to London (Vice), New York (Edun), Sweden (where Mathambo lives) and Johannesburg, where Becatti and Picture Tree are located.</p>
<p><a href="http://www.onesmallseed.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/08/spoek6.jpg"><img src="http://www.onesmallseed.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/08/spoek6.jpg" alt="" title="spoek6" width="600" height="329" class="aligncenter size-full wp-image-36061" /></a></p>
<p><a href="http://www.onesmallseed.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/08/spoek5.jpg"><img src="http://www.onesmallseed.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/08/spoek5.jpg" alt="" title="spoek5" width="600" height="328" class="aligncenter size-full wp-image-36060" /></a></p>
<p>Shot in a scrapyard in the south of Johannnesburg, Awufuni showcases some amazing South Africa talent, including four professional dancers &#8211; Robyn Brophy, Melissa Flerangile, Sne Mbatha and Tebogo Ribane. Street casting in Soweto also unearthed a major new talent in schoolgirl, Amanda Magi who plays the main girl gang member and ‘cat lady’. </p>
<p>Mathambo on Magi’s performance in the video:</p>
<blockquote><p>‘She has something about her – an electricity. I’m excited for her to get her chance to do what she does best’</p></blockquote>
<p>The Becatti-helmed Awufuni is part of the second season of Diesel and Edun’s Studio Africa. The Autumn/Winter 2013 initiative sees Studio Africa champion three African musicians – Spoek, Faarrow and Olugbuenga.</p>

<p><strong>On a technical note.</strong></p>
<p>The DOP on Awufuni was David Pienaar and the video was shot mostly on Steadicam (Chris Vermaak) to minimize time between set-ups. The use of the Steadicam also allowed for quick dynamic movements, and equally quick changes as the camera is rolling. &#8216;Because there were so many set-ups to be nailed in a 12-hour period, this seemed the most logical choice,&#8217; comments Becatti. The shoot day was on the second shortest day of the year in terms of daylight hours, and so it was exceptionally challenging to pull of, and the time constraints were very tight.’ The video was shot on RED Epic, using Cooke S4 mini’s, the Allura Zoom lens, and for the super wide shots, the Nikkor 8mm Fish-eye. The choice was made to shoot in 1:2.39 aspect ratio for its cinematic qualities, given the narrative aspect. </p>

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><strong>On Thursday 14 August, <a href="http://www.adidas.com/com/originals/" target="_blank">adidas Originals</a> showcased key looks from their upcoming Spring Summer &#8217;13 range at an exclusive, VIP fashion show hosted at <a href="http://www.area3.co.za/" target="_blank">AREA3</a>. The project that led to the exhibition was developed to create an honest, bottom-up story that would resonate with the people who love the adidas brand.</strong><span id="more-36011"></span></p>
<div id="attachment_36025" style="width: 610px" class="wp-caption aligncenter"><a href="http://www.onesmallseed.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/08/Nelis-Botha_adidas_area3_037web.jpg"><img src="http://www.onesmallseed.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/08/Nelis-Botha_adidas_area3_037web.jpg" alt="" title="photo: Nelis Botha" width="600" height="400" class="size-full wp-image-36025" /></a><p class="wp-caption-text">photo: Nelis Botha</p></div>
<p>The theme, &#8216;All Originals&#8217;, reflects the very nature of the Originals brand and was incorporated into all elements of the project: from the selection of pieces, photography and video style, even down to the recruitment and selection of the models used in the show and campaign collateral.</p>
<p>In order to engage original influencers to act as models, a unique casting call was put out, but for models that weren’t already signed, established or trained as such. The casting call was held at <a href="http://www.area3.co.za/" target="_blank">www.area3.co.za</a> in a single day and all potentials were shot in the pieces that they would eventually wear at the fashion show and showcase in campaign collateral – it was an original experience. </p>

<p>The subsequent exhibition has been designed to allow people a chance to witness the project in a longer-lasting format, featuring life-size prints of the models and campaign with Q&#038;A’s of each model involved, video projections from the show and the afro-electric sounds of Markus Wormstorm (who musically steered the evening) as well as, of course, featured adidas Originals pieces from the show.</p>
<p>Some of the signature items as well as imagery and video footage from the show will be exhibited in AREA3 from Tuesday, 20 August until Sunday, 22 September and will be open to the public. </p>
